Beautiful Suffering: Photography and the Traffic in Pain (Paperback)
by Mark Reinhardt (Editor), Holly Edwards (Editor), Erina Duganne (Editor) Susan Sontag once remarked that since the invention of the camera, photography has “kept company with death.” And indeed, images of suffering human beings and devastated landscapes appear regularly in the popular media and even in contemporary art. This volume explores these painful images from the [...] Read More
